But not leaving negative feedback does not warn other buyers in the future. One only has to look at the number reversed negs on sellers accounts sometimes running into 100s to realise they regularly coerce buyers to change their feedback. Negative feedback is also the only thing that affects a sellers power seller status, once they lose that they are on the slippery slope. Your ebay account is safe so long as its got a secure long password thats not been used anywhere else, eg your email account.

I would not have any worries about leaving negative feedback, what's the worse they can do? call you names?
